Pasar al contenido principal
Submitted by kinta on
Imagen

Pasadas las pruebas de concepto y las pruebas con experiencia real en tres cursos distintos ya podemos anunciar que zaya queda disponible como recurso para la realización de itinerarios formativos y de autoaprendizaje. ¿donde estará disponible? Te lo explicamos

 

Zaya fue planteada como aplicación en sí misma, pero debido al coste que significaría desarrollar de zero tanto el núcleo como todos los módulos para satisfacer las necesidades, decidimos partir de la base de un marco de trabajo existente. Debido a la práctica que tenemos tiramos por Drupal, por lo que aporta en cuanto a infraestructura, comunidad y base.  Aun así, el esquema y la arquitectura podría llegar a replicarse en otros entornos. 

Entendiendo las partes:

Drupal es el núcleo que lleva consigo partes esenciales, como gestión de los usuarios, gestión de contenidos, gestión de componentes y gestión de extensiones y temas de apariencia.

Encima suyo tenemos otros módulos que aportan funcionalidades que requerimos, como los módulos de grupo, para la gestión de grupos, sus  usuarios y sus contenidos.

A partir de aquí vienen los desarrollos propios hechos con la fundación repoblación y communalia: Un conjunto de módulos que dan la funcionalidad deseada:

El módulo zaya, que añade tipos de grupo de itinerario con todo configurado, y un submódulo (zaya_events), que controla los eventos que se lanzan para ir completando el itinerario. 

El tema radix_zaya: Para poder ver de forma óptima los contenidos y poder asegurar una buena experiencia de usuario, también se ha creado un tema gráfico basado en radix. Sobre el cual se podría extender el estilo y apariencia  que se quiera creando un subtema de este. 

Para que no se haga difícil la instalación, se ha desarrollado también unas recetas de drupal, la forma como se propone para drupal cms y drupal 11 para instalar suites: 

Las recetas facilitan una instalación más facil sobre un drupal o sobre una nueva instalación.

La intención al liberar toda esta base de código es clara:

El conocimiento libre requiere ser entendido y administrado como un comunal para poder prosperar.

Para ser utilizado y administrado para cooperativas y colectivos que pongan en el objectivo de su modelo el hecho de no bloquear código o conocimiento de forma general y que se entienda como un comunal, patrimonio público de las entidades que lo utilicen. 

...la cooperativa de trabajo que se articula en torno a un comunal de conocimiento libre - Desarrollar tecnologías para usarlas y extender su uso. no venderlas o rentabilizarlas. Desde el inicio cooperativas de trabajo, ni propietarios ni consumidores, que el desarrollo de un comunal con su explotación sea por la necesidad de usarlo, quedando a resguardo de las presiones por convertirlo en una fuente de rentas.

 

Zaya es un software libre con la licencia GPL2 o posterior, por lo que hay procesos de colaboración, aprendizaje y conversación en comunidades específicas. Con la premisa de que está programado para permitirnos estudiar el código, la libertad de distribuirlo, la libertad de mejorarla y la libertad de usarlo.

Añadir nuevo comentario
El contenido de este campo se mantiene privado y no se mostrará públicamente.
CAPTCHA
This question is for testing whether or not you are a human visitor and to prevent automated spam submissions.